1. Zeekr Innovations at CES 2025
Zeekr, a premium electric mobility brand, has made a
significant impact at CES 2025 with its latest technological advancements. One
of the key highlights is their intelligent driving domain controller powered by
NVIDIA's DRIVE AGX Thor. This system is designed to manage various autonomous
driving scenarios, making it a vital component for future autonomous vehicles.
The intelligent driving domain controller utilizes advanced AI and machine
learning algorithms to enhance vehicle safety and efficiency, ensuring a
smoother and more reliable autonomous driving experience.
In addition to
this, Zeekr announced a global energy solution featuring an 800V ultra-fast
charging system. This system aims to reduce charging times significantly,
allowing EVs to charge to 80% capacity in just a few minutes. Zeekr's
commitment to expanding its charging infrastructure is evident in their plans
to establish a network of branded charging stations, starting in Thailand and
Australia. These developments are poised to address one of the biggest
challenges facing the EV industry – the need for a widespread and efficient
charging network.
2. Honda's New Electric Prototypes
At CES 2025, Honda unveiled two new prototype electric cars
based on the 0 Series concept. These prototypes include an SUV and a saloon,
both featuring an all-new infotainment operating system. This new system offers
a more intuitive and user-friendly interface, integrating seamlessly with the
vehicles' advanced features.
The infotainment
system includes AI-driven voice controls, enhanced navigation capabilities, and
support for the latest connectivity standards, making it a key selling point
for tech-savvy consumers.
The prototypes are expected to enter production in 2026,
marking Honda's continued commitment to expanding its electric vehicle lineup.
Honda's focus on integrating cutting-edge technology into their vehicles is a
clear indication of their strategy to compete in the rapidly evolving EV
market. These prototypes represent the next step in Honda's journey towards a
more sustainable and technologically advanced future.
3. BMW's iDrive System Launch
BMW is set to revolutionize the in-car experience with the
introduction of a new infotainment system, featuring a panoramic display. This
new system, set to be featured in upcoming BMW models by late 2025, offers a
significantly enhanced user interface compared to previous versions. The
panoramic display provides a more immersive and interactive experience,
allowing drivers and passengers to access a wide range of features and services
with ease.
The new iDrive system integrates advanced AI capabilities,
offering personalized recommendations and real-time information to enhance the
driving experience. BMW's focus on improving the in-car interface is part of
their broader strategy to stay ahead in the competitive luxury vehicle market.
The new iDrive system is expected to set a new standard for in-car technology,
providing a seamless and connected experience for BMW owners.
4. Battery Technology Trends
The EV sector is experiencing rapid advancements in battery
technology, addressing some of the key challenges that have previously hindered
widespread adoption of electric vehicles. One of the most notable trends is the
development of batteries that can charge to 80% capacity in under an hour. This
improvement in battery chemistry not only reduces charging times but also
enhances the overall performance and longevity of the batteries.
Modern electric vehicles now offer ranges of 200 to 300
miles on a single charge, significantly reducing concerns about range anxiety.
These advancements are driven by ongoing research and development efforts aimed
at improving energy density, reducing costs, and increasing the sustainability
of battery production. Innovations in solid-state batteries, fast-charging
technologies, and energy storage solutions are poised to further accelerate the
growth of the EV market.
5. Upcoming Electric Vehicles
The automotive industry is gearing up for numerous electric vehicles
launches in 2025, showcasing the growing momentum of the EV revolution. Here
are some of the most anticipated models:
- Acura
ZDX: Acura's first EV, built on new architecture, is set to launch in
late 2025. This model represents Acura's entry into the electric vehicle
market, offering a combination of performance, luxury, and advanced
technology.
- Audi
Q6 e-tron: Expected to offer around 300 miles of range and rapid
charging capabilities, the Audi Q6 e-tron aims to provide a premium
electric driving experience. Audi's focus on integrating advanced driver
assistance systems and cutting-edge infotainment features makes this model
a strong contender in the luxury EV segment.
- Chevrolet
Corvette EV: An all-electric version of the iconic sports car is
anticipated soon, leveraging GM's Ultium platform. The Corvette EV is
expected to deliver the exhilarating performance that the Corvette is
known for, combined with the benefits of electric propulsion.
6. Rohde & Schwarz Innovations
Rohde & Schwarz showcased significant innovations in
automotive radar testing and in-vehicle network testing at CES 2025. Their
advancements in radar technology are crucial for the development of advanced
driver assistance systems (ADAS) and autonomous driving capabilities. By
providing high-precision testing solutions, Rohde & Schwarz is enabling
automakers to develop safer and more reliable vehicles.
Their in-vehicle network testing solutions are designed to
ensure the seamless integration of complex infotainment systems, enhancing the
overall user experience. These innovations are essential for the development of
next-generation vehicles that offer advanced connectivity and automation
features.
7. LG Innotek Mobility Innovations
LG Innotek unveiled a range of mobility innovations,
including an RGB-IR In-Cabin Camera Module designed to detect driver
drowsiness. This module utilizes advanced image processing algorithms to
monitor the driver's condition and provide timely alerts to prevent accidents.
The All-Weather Camera Solution, another highlight from LG Innotek, is designed
to function effectively in various environmental conditions, ensuring reliable
performance regardless of weather.
These innovations highlight LG Innotek's commitment to
enhancing vehicle safety and improving the overall driving experience through
advanced sensor technology.
8. Aptera Motors Solar-Powered EV
Aptera Motors introduced a solar-powered EV with one of the
lowest drag coefficients of any production passenger car. This innovative
vehicle is designed to harness solar energy, providing a sustainable and
efficient alternative to traditional electric vehicles. The Aptera EV's
lightweight design and aerodynamic shape contribute to its impressive range and
performance.
By integrating solar panels into the vehicle's body, Aptera
Motors is pushing the boundaries of sustainable transportation, offering a
glimpse into the future of energy-efficient vehicles.
9. Continental's Smart Tires
Continental unveiled their latest innovation in tire
technology – smart tires equipped with embedded sensors. These sensors
continuously monitor the tire's condition, including pressure, temperature, and
tread depth, providing real-time data to the driver. This information helps
optimize vehicle performance, enhance safety, and extend the lifespan of the
tires.
Continental's smart tires represent a significant step
forward in the integration of IoT (Internet of Things) technology into
automotive components, contributing to the development of smarter and more
connected vehicles.
10. Rivian's Adventure Network Expansion
Rivian announced the expansion of its Adventure Network, a
series of fast-charging stations strategically located to support long-distance
travel for Rivian owners. This network is designed to provide reliable and
convenient charging options in remote and adventure-ready locations, enhancing
the overall ownership experience for Rivian drivers.
The expansion of the Adventure Network aligns with Rivian's
mission to promote sustainable and adventure-oriented lifestyles, providing the
infrastructure needed to support their rugged and versatile electric vehicles.
